Ingredients

  • Fresh chicken breast: Easy to cut into strips for perfect texture. Select chicken that is pink and firm
  • Good Caesar dressing: Creamy and tangy. Use one with real parmesan and anchovy for authentic flavor
  • Romaine lettuce: Chopped for crunch. Choose leaves that are crisp and bright green
  • Flour: Gives chicken its golden crust. Use unbleached all-purpose for best results
  • Eggs: Bind the coating and give it body. Look for eggs with bright yellow yolks
  • Croutons: Classic Caesar crunch. Pick a sturdy style that holds up in the wrap
  • Grated parmesan: For salty tang. Buy in a block and grate yourself for strongest flavor
  • Large flour tortillas: Soft and pliable for rolling. Select fresh tortillas that bend without cracking
  • High-heat spray oil: Ensures crispy chicken. Look for avocado oil for best browning and light taste

Step-by-Step Instructions

Chicken Preparation:
Cut the chicken breasts into even strips about one inch wide. Prepare one bowl each with seasoned flour and beaten eggs. Mix salt, pepper, and a touch of paprika into the flour. Set your breading station in order flour eggs flour.
Coating Process:
Dredge each chicken strip in your seasoned flour shaking off any excess. Dip into the beaten eggs letting any extra drip away. Return to the flour mixture and coat well pressing to ensure the flour sticks. Arrange prepared strips on a rack and spray lightly with oil.
Air Frying:
Preheat your air fryer to 380 degrees Fahrenheit for at least three minutes. Lay the chicken strips in a single layer in the fryer basket leaving space between each piece. Mist with oil. Cook for about twelve minutes flipping strips halfway through until they are golden and cooked through.
Assembly Process:
Warm tortillas for a few seconds in the microwave or on a pan until just soft and flexible. Add a layer of crisp chopped romaine down the middle. Sprinkle a little parmesan and scatter some croutons for crunch. Place several crispy chicken strips on top drizzle with Caesar dressing and gently roll up the tortilla tightly folding in the sides as you go.

Storage Tips

For freshest wraps store components separately. Keep cooked chicken in a tightly sealed container chilled and lettuce in a dry salad spinner. Assemble wraps when ready to eat and add croutons at the last minute to keep them crunchy. Wrapping unopened wraps in foil keeps them fresh for lunch boxes for up to three days.

Ingredient Substitutions

Swap chicken tenders for regular breasts if preferred. For a dairy-free version use vegan parmesan and creamy garlic dressing instead of Caesar. Whole wheat tortillas work nicely if you want a hearty alternative. Replace croutons with toasted pepitas or chopped nuts for a gluten-free crunch.

Serving Suggestions

Pair wraps with fresh-cut fruit salad or classic potato wedges for a filling meal. They also work well with sliced pickles fresh cherry tomatoes or even a bowl of tomato soup especially in colder months.

Texture Management

To keep every component at its best dry washed lettuce thoroughly before using. Warm your tortillas so they roll smoothly without tearing and wait until just before eating to add the chicken and croutons so the wrap stays crisp not soggy.

Recipe FAQs

→ Can these wraps be prepared ahead of time?

Yes, you can store the components separately in the fridge for 2-3 days. Keep the chicken strips, salad mix, and dressing apart, assembling just before serving to maintain crispness.

→ How do I ensure the chicken is fully cooked?

Use a thermometer to check that the chicken’s internal temperature reaches 165°F. This guarantees juiciness and safety without overcooking.

→ What’s the best way to keep the chicken crispy?

Double-coating the chicken and spraying it lightly with oil before air frying creates a golden, crunchy crust that holds up well in the wrap.

→ Can these wraps be eaten cold?

Yes, they maintain flavor and texture even when served cold or at room temperature, making them convenient for packed lunches.

→ How should the lettuce and tortillas be handled for best texture?

Ensure the romaine lettuce is completely dry to avoid sogginess. Warm the tortillas slightly before assembling to improve flexibility and prevent cracking.

Ingredients

→ Chicken

01 450 grams fresh chicken breast, cut into uniform strips
02 100 grams all-purpose flour, seasoned with salt and pepper
03 2 large eggs, beaten until smooth
04 Cooking oil spray

→ Salad

05 150 grams romaine lettuce, thoroughly dried and chopped
06 50 grams parmesan cheese, grated
07 30 grams crunchy croutons
08 60 milliliters Caesar dressing

→ Wrap

09 4 soft tortillas, warmed slightly for flexibility

Steps

Step 01

Cut the chicken breast into uniform strips to ensure even cooking. Set up a breading station with seasoned flour and beaten eggs ready.

Step 02

Dredge each chicken strip in seasoned flour, dip into the beaten eggs, then coat again in the flour mixture for a double layer. Place coated strips on a rack and spray lightly with cooking oil spray.

Step 03

Preheat the air fryer to 193°C (380°F). Arrange the chicken strips in a single layer without overcrowding. Spray again lightly with cooking oil spray and cook for 11-12 minutes, flipping halfway through, until golden and crispy.

Step 04

Warm tortillas slightly to increase pliability. Evenly layer romaine lettuce, parmesan cheese, croutons, and Caesar dressing on each tortilla. Place the crispy chicken strips strategically on top.

Step 05

Roll each tortilla tightly, tucking in the sides to secure the filling. Serve immediately or wrap tightly for meal prep purposes.

Notes

  1. Ensure chicken is cooked to an internal temperature of 74°C (165°F) for safety and optimal juiciness.
  2. Do not overcrowd the air fryer basket to maintain crispiness.
  3. Let chicken rest a few minutes after frying before slicing to preserve juices.
  4. Prepare and store salad and dressing separately when packing for later consumption to avoid sogginess.
